Analysis of Both Teams

France has been performing in a consistent yet effective manner recently, despite dealing with injuries to key players. They have already secured victories in their previous World Cup Qualifiers and are looking to continue their winning streak. On the other hand, Iceland has had a mixed run of form in 2025, but they showed their potential by scoring five goals against Azerbaijan in their last outing.

Goals Galore in Reykjavík

The history between Iceland and France has often seen high-scoring matches, with over 2.5 goals being scored in eight of their last 10 meetings. Despite missing some key players, France still possesses attacking threats in players like Mbappe and Coman. Iceland will have their work cut out for them defensively.

France’s Icelandic Challenge

Although Iceland has never managed to defeat France in their encounters, they have consistently made the matches competitive. Matches between the two sides have often seen both teams finding the back of the net. While Iceland can be a threat, France is still likely to come out on top.
